We have two objectives. First, we want to build a system for detecting tetratricopeptide repeats in protein sequences. Second, we want to demonstrate how the general bioinformatics database integration system called Kleisli can help build such a system easily. We achieve these two objectives by showing that short and clear programs can be written in Kleisli, using its high-level query language CPL, to build a TPR domain hunter by integrating WU-BLAST2.0, HMMER, Entrez, and PFAM.
